frequently asked questions about autopay

Here you will find answers to frequently asked questions about autopay.

What happens when I drive in front of the terminal?

Our Autopay concept is based on vehicle registration number identification. The identification system determines when your parking starts and ends when you drive in and out of the parking area.  

Do I have to pay every time I park in front of the terminal?

Only if you stay longer than 7 minutes.

How do I pay?

You can pay at machine, at onepepark.no within 48 hours, by invoice in the mail. If you have registered as customer earlier then your parking will be debited automatically when leaving the parking area.

How long can I stay before I have to pay for parking?

At the forecourt at the departure area at Oslo Airport you can stay for 7 minutes for short pick up or drop. If you stay longer than 7 minutes you must pay for your stay.

Where do you find the information about me?

The Autopay concept is based on vehicle registration number identification. The identification system determines when your parking starts and ends when you drive in and out of the parking area. If you do not pay for your parking, the registered owner of the viechle will receive an invoice.

Why do I have received an invoice for parking?

A car registered on you has stayed longer than the specified time in the forecourt at the departures area at Oslo Airport. OnePark has not received payment within 48 hours and have sent the invoice to the registered owner of the viechle.

I parked and went to the payment machine to register. Then I read the received amount was kr. 0. But I have received an invoice afterwards?

You can stay for 7 minutes. If you try to register the vehicle at the payment machine during this time, it will show kr. 0 at the screen. Note that a  fee will be charged if your stay is longer than 7 minutes.

What do I do if I do not drive my own car?

If you do not drive your own car, it is recommended to pay for the parking at the payment machine when you leave.
